How much do union computer science j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 30, 2026, the average yearly pay for union computer science in Birmingham, AL is $59,710.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$36,536.00 and $78,097.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are 5 jobs you can get with computer science?

With a computer science degree, you can pursue roles such as software developer, systems analyst, cybersecurity analyst, data scientist, and network administrator. These jobs typically require programming skills, knowledge of algorithms, and familiarity with tools like databases and operating systems.

What are some typical challenges faced by computer science professionals in unionized environments?

Computer science professionals in unionized settings often face unique challenges such as balancing organizational technology goals with collectively bargained work agreements and navigating structured processes for workflow changes or new initiatives. Adhering to union regulations can add extra layers of documentation and collaboration, especially when implementing new systems or managing cross-team projects. However, these environments also offer clear protocols for conflict resolution, opportunities for professional development, and strong support systems. Successfully adapting to these dynamics not only enhances project outcomes but also supports a positive and equitable work culture.

What is a Union Computer Science job?

A Union Computer Science job refers to a position in the tech industry that falls under a labor union, meaning employees have collective bargaining rights for fair wages, benefits, and working conditions. These jobs can exist in various sectors, including government, education, and private industries where unions are established. Workers in these roles may benefit from job security, standardized pay scales, and grievance procedures. Unionization in computer science helps ensure fair treatment and advocate for workers' rights in an ever-evolving industry.

Job description

Job Summary:
Mindlance is a company seeking an experienced Data Scientist to leverage advanced analytics and machine learning to inform business decisions. The role involves data analysis, predictive modeling, and collaboration with cross-functional teams to drive data initiatives and mentor junior staff.
Responsibilities:
โ€ข Expertly handle complex data sets, conduct in-depth data analysis, and derive actionable insights by applying advanced statistical and machine learning techniques.
โ€ข Develop and deploy sophisticated machine learning models, utilizing algorithms like deep learning, ensemble methods, and neural networks to predict trends, behaviors, and outcomes.
โ€ข Create compelling data visualizations that effectively communicate complex findings and insights using tools like Tableau, Power BI, or custom Python visualizations.
โ€ข Lead feature engineering efforts to identify and select critical data features, enhancing the predictive power of machine learning models.
โ€ข Formulate, implement, and test hypotheses, providing robust statistical validation for key business decisions.
โ€ข Lead the development of machine learning algorithms and their optimization to solve complex business problems.
โ€ข Collaborate with IT and data engineering teams to integrate and access data from various sources, data lakes, and data warehouses.
โ€ข Oversee the deployment of machine learning models in production environments to support real-time decision-making and business applications.
โ€ข Design and analyze A/B tests to measure the impact of changes, optimizations, and improvements.
โ€ข Ensure ethical data practices, privacy compliance, and adherence to data protection regulations in all data science initiatives.
โ€ข Collaborate closely with cross functional teams, including engineers, business analysts, domain experts, and executives to understand business requirements and align data science initiatives with organizational goals.
โ€ข Provide mentorship and guidance to junior data scientists, fostering their growth and development.
โ€ข Act as a strategic leader, influencing data-driven culture across the organization, defining the data science roadmap, and contributing to long term data strategy.
โ€ข Stay updated on the latest data science tools, techniques, and trends, continuously innovating and evaluating new technologies to improve data science practices.
Qualifications:
Required:
โ€ข 10 to 15 years of experience in data science, including an extensive track record of implementing data solutions and driving data driven decision-making
โ€ข Proficiency in data analysis tools and programming languages such as Python, R, or Julia
โ€ข Expert knowledge of machine learning algorithms and their applications
โ€ข Exceptional skills in data visualization tools like Tableau, Power BI, or data visualization libraries in Python (e.g., Matplotlib, Seaborn)
โ€ข Profound understanding of databases and data manipulation using SQL
โ€ข Outstanding problem-solving and critical thinking abilities
โ€ข Strong leadership and communication skills, capable of conveying complex findings and insights to both technical and non-technical stakeholders
โ€ข Extensive experience with big data technologies and distributed computing frameworks (e.g., Hadoop, Spark)
โ€ข Expertise in data ethics, privacy, and compliance considerations
Preferred:
โ€ข Master's or Ph.D. in a quantitative field preferred (e.g., Computer Science, Statistics, Mathematics, Engineering)
